For Heat Wave, because Castle is kind of a campy, funny, best-seller kind of guy, we can be more forgiving of some tongue in cheek humor and camp.
That aside, i just finished reading God Hates Us All and while I definitely enjoyed the book, i had a few issues with it. I would have preferred if they didn't refer to the show in the art for the book, just had it exactly as it appeared in the show, with Moody's picture on the back and everything. The front cover is cool, but yeah it would have been nice, maybe i'm just a perfectionist prick. Also i fail to see how the story they published could have been turned into what we saw as being 'A Crazy Little Thing Called Love' on the show, especially with the scenes that we saw being filmed with Tom and Katie. But i mean, i'm really looking for flaws, Californication is like my passion in life so i'm happy to have something at least. I'd give this release a 3.5-4/5 based on what i wanted out of the release, and 4-4.5/5 for the story, all connections aside. Enjoy it.
